Overview
Municipal wastewater treatment is a critical component of urban infrastructure, responsible for processing over 4.3 billion gallons of wastewater daily in the United States alone, with a total investment of over $115 billion in the past decade. The treatment process involves a combination of physical, chemical, and biological methods to remove pollutants and contaminants, with a focus on meeting stringent environmental regulations. However, the industry faces challenges such as aging infrastructure, climate change, and emerging contaminants, with 75% of wastewater treatment plants in the US requiring upgrades or replacement. Despite these challenges, innovations in technologies such as membrane bioreactors and advanced oxidation processes are improving treatment efficiency and reducing environmental impact. As the global population urbanizes, the importance of effective municipal wastewater treatment will only continue to grow, with the World Health Organization estimating that $650 billion will be needed to meet global wastewater treatment demands by 2030.
